Exploring the Significant Perks of coworking spaces



Choosing shared workspaces offers a multitude of significant advantages compared to conventional office setups. These advantages contribute significantly in the widespread appeal of the coworking model across the globe. Businesses are drawn to the mix of community these spaces offer. Key highlights encompass:


  • Cost Efficiency: Significantly lower monthly expenses compared to renting and equipping a private office, rendering office space rental more accessible.

  • Scalability: Month-to-month agreements enable adjustments based on needs without long-term leases.

  • Networking Opportunities: Built-in opportunities to connect with various professionals across multiple industries.

  • Included Facilities: Utilize meeting rooms, coffee/tea, reception services, and more usually provided in the membership fee.

  • Prime Locations: Presence in desirable business locations avoiding the high cost of a traditional lease in those areas.

Everything You Need to Know About Coworking Workspaces



  • Q: What are the main types of shared workspaces available?

    A: Shared workspaces come in different types, including: hot desks (unassigned desks in a shared area), dedicated desks (a specific desk in a shared space), and private office for rent (secure offices suited for teams requiring privacy). Many also offer meeting room memberships.

  • Q: Is coworking spaces suitable for larger businesses or just startups?

    A: While coworking spaces are highly favored among startups, they are definitely attractive to established companies. Benefits for them are flexibility for remote teams, market entry points, operational agility, and access to networking opportunities. Many providers offer larger private office for rent options to accommodate corporate needs.

  • Q: What's generally included with an office space rental in a coworking environment?

    read more A: Rental fees in shared office spaces usually cover beyond the physical space. Common inclusions are: high-speed internet access, electricity, water, heating/cooling, basic furniture, lounges, kitchens, cleaning services, and sometimes free coffee/tea. Use of meeting rooms may have credits separate charges, depending on the specific plan.
